Baseball Preview: Redbank Valley Bulldogs vs. Freedom Area Bulldogs
Redbank Valley will venture away from home to face off against Freedom Area at 11:00 a.m. on Thursday. Each of these teams will be fighting to keep a win streak alive as Redbank Valley comes in on ten and Freedom Area on six.
Redbank Valley is on a roll after a high-stakes playoff matchup on Monday. They came out on top in a nail-biter against Greenville, sneaking past 8-7.
Jaxon Huffman made a big impact no matter where he played. He looked comfortable on the mound, striking out seven batters over 6.2 innings while giving up just one earned (and one unearned) run off six hits. He has been nothing but reliable: he hasn't given up more than one earned run in three consecutive appearances. He was also big at the plate, going 2-for-5 with one stolen base and one RBI.

Huffman wasn't the only one making solid contact as five players wound up with at least one hit. One of them was Carson Gould, who went 4-for-7 with one home run, three runs, and four RBI. Those four hits gave Gould a new career-high.
Meanwhile, Freedom Area was not the first on the board on Monday, but they got there more often. They sure made it a nail-biter, but they managed to escape with a 5-3 win over Bishop McCort.
Tommy Ward was excellent, going 1-for-2 with one stolen base, one run, and one RBI. Mason O'Donnell was another key player, going 1-for-3 with one triple, one run, and one RBI.
Freedom Area's victory was their seventh straight at home, which pushed their record up to 16-7. They've had to fight for that success though, as they only beat their opponents by an average of five runs across that stretch. As for Redbank Valley, their record now sits at 15-8.
